MgAl-LDH fixes the chrome tanning agent by adsorption. Thisdesign greatly reduces the chromium content in the waste liquid, makingthe leather tanning process cleaner and more sustainable. In this work, a highly efficient tanning agent was developedbycombining magnesium-aluminum-layered double hydroxide (MgAl-LDH)with different Mg:Al molar ratios and 2% chrome (MgAl-LDH-2%Cr composite).MgAl-LDH-2% Cr (at 1 Mg:1 Al molar ratio for a 4-hour aging period)showed a much higher leather shrinkage temperature (Ts) of up to 93.8 & DEG;C upon tanning than a bare 2% chrome tanning agent (74.2 & DEG;C).The use of MgAl-LDH-2%Cr in the tanning process was also environmentallyfriendly, as it helped reduce the leaching amount of chromium ionsin the tanning effluent (e.g., from 99.6 to 35.0 mg L-1), accompanied by the reduction of BOD5 and COD-Cr by67% and 46%, respectively (relative to the conventional chrome tanningprocess). The improved tanning effects can possibly be accountedfor by the adsorption of a positive chromium complex onto MgAl-LDHlaminates with hydroxyl groups to obtain a better tanning effect throughthe penetration of chromium into skin collagen fibers.
